medic / cht-user-management

GNU Affero General Public License v3.0
3 stars 1 forks source link

Add configuration which disallows login as admin #101

Open kennsippell opened 3 months ago

kennsippell commented 3 months ago

Once we create the user accounts for KE User Managers via https://github.com/medic/cht-user-management/issues/79, we don't want anybody to use the medic super user account anymore.

On Feb 21, we announced:

Everyone's usernames will be present in the data they create. This is an important step in our road toward an auditable user creation process with explicit recorded approval. I propose that on Apr 1, users will no longer be able to login to the tool as admin (username medic).

This tracks disallowing login via medic once accounts are created and distributed